Housed in a former mechanic’s workshop in the centre of Leura, this award-winning, eco-friendly cafe and bar opened in 2011. You can see elements of the buildings past life around the space, like the car hoist used as a wine rack and plant pots made from stacks of tires.
There’s a focus on seasonal produce and small regional suppliers, with truffles from Oberon, saffron from Capertee, trout from Nundle, herbs from Lawson and olive oil from Mudgee appearing on the menu. Tuck into stone baked pizzas, share the 1.2 kilogram slow roasted lamb shoulder, or try a bit of everything with the tasting menu.
